10/15/96 AMS' " Strategic Plan for the London Road Facility" (" Plan")

As part of license compliance efforts, AMS is faced with numerous tasks ranging from very involved (license renewal application, underground drainage remediation, etc.),

i i

to routine surveys and reports. Due to limited personnel assets and financial resources, the tasks are prioritized and scheduled ac,cordingly to effect the maximum cost / benefits in a timely and efficient manner. This Plan is AMS' outline to accomplish this, and updates have been submitted quarterly.

The following Plans and revisions have been issued:

i Initial Plan October 11,1995 Revision 1 January 15,1996 i

Revision 2 April 11,1996 Revision 3 July 10,1996 i

The Plan divides the actions into high, intermediate, lower priority and on-going actions. (High priority has action planned in the next 12 months; intermediate priority j

has 1 - 3 years planning; low priority has 3 - 5 years planning) The following information is the update as of the lasted revision listed above:

Hiah Priority Actions Complete the Remediation Report This action included remediating the large amounts of water that infiltrated into the basement of the facility when the lateral was plugged by NEORSD, remova the CO-60 from that water, remediate the foundation drains, isolate the manhole and lateral, and remediate the NEORSD interceptor.

The Co-60 has been removed from the water from the basement, which is being stored in four 25,000 gallon bladders; the 100,000 gallons has about 40 microcuries (calculated), which gives around 100 picocuries per liter, less than the EPA drinking water standard for Co-60. Disposition of this water has not been determined.

i in the remediation of the foundation drains, which were replaced, there was contaminated soil that was isolated, piled in an lined wooden structure that still needs final disposition, but is part of the surveillance plan. The surveillance plan for residual activity outside the AMS building around the abandon foundation drains and lateral connector has been deferred, as per license amendment 43.

The disposition of the water in the WHUT room is still undetermined. AMS is investigating a stabilizing material called STERGO, which is a cross-linked polymer that absorbs and retains large amounts of water. AMS IS WAITING FOR NRC TO t

l Intermediate Priority Actions Recover Hot Cell Capabilities Cross contamination was a concern because of the levels of contamination in the hot cell. After an evaluation, improved lighting and a source transfer mechanism was all that was needed to make the cell operational by the end of 1995.

Retum NPI Sources in July 1996, there were 34 sealed sources (? activity) at AMS that belonged to NPl.

As sources are bought from NPI to delivery to an AMS client, AMS sends a shipping container to NPI, now with a source in it for retum to NPl. NPI will allow only one source per shipment.

Identify a Market for Remaining Sources and Bulk Material Originally attempting to sell or give source to any market that AMS could find. This has been abandoned, and AMS is disposing of the bulk and sealed sources at Barnwell via Chem-Nuclear as broker; a contract is in place, and AMS is awaiting the approval of the safety procedures. This is part of the Building Recovery Project, is begin addressed now, and should be under the high priority.

Lower Priority Action Removal of Plug in the Hot Cell About 4,000 curies of sealed Co-60 are located in a storage well in the hot cell, but the hot cell plug is vuck, precluding a physical inventory. A contract for removal of the plug has been let(?). Once decision (?) made and permits approved, the project will begin.

Decontamination of Hot Cell AMS plans to decontaminate the Hot Cell to levels necessary to support planned future operations.

Complete / Confirm the Physical Inventory and Transfer / Ship Remaining Sources To be done after plug is removed from well. Intends to ask for an amendment to condition 14.c., requesting an exemption from physical inventory until after plug removed. (at the moment, they are in violation of their license condition)

Disposition of Solid Waste at the Facility About 3,000 cubic feet (400 fifty-five gallon drums) exist and stored at AMS. Looking

at disposal at same time as the bulk and sealed Co-60. AMS waiting for NRC procedure approval and is attempting negotiations with different brokers for disposal.

This is addressed in the Building Recovery Project, being addressed now, and should be under high priority.

4 Disposition of Treated Water in Collapsible Storage Tank i

Water from the basement flood was treated using sub-micron filtration and reverse 4

osmosis to reduce cobalt-60 to below drinking water levels; presently 100,000 gallons of treated water are being stored in storage tanks. AMS has EPA approval to evaporate, but that has become too expensive for 100,000 gallons. Not a radiological hazard; they are pursuing other options for disposal.

10/16/96 Subj: Building Recover Project Task 1, Disposal of Sealed and Bulk Co-60 at Commercial Low-Level Waste Burial l

Site. Task describes the proposal to contract a broker to dispose of the 44,000 curies at Barnwell. The major impact of this proposal effects the i

Letter of Credit of the Decommissioning Financial Assurance for the DfP. AMS wishes to use some of the money tied up in the Letter of Credit to dispose of the Co-60, and this would need NRC approval.

NRC has approved this money adjustment in Amendment 44. The safety procedures have been approved and RIII is about to give the go ahead for Chem-Nuclear to proceed with the disposal shipment.

Task 2, Disposal of the Dry Solid Waste Stored at the Facility.

This task is in conjunction with Task 1, with the same monetary provision. At present, AMS is still trying to negotiate with another waste broker besides Chem-Nuclear to procure a best price for the disposal. There is about 3,000 cubic feet of dry solid waste to be disposed (400 fifty-five gallon drums).

Task 3, Radiological Stabilization of the Basement.

The task is the l

decontamination of the basement area for unrestricted release of the basement, outside of the Waste Hold Up Tank (WHUT) room, and the j

stabilization of the radioactive material in the WHUT room, to ensure that liquids do not enter or exit the room for the duration of the safe storage period.

It is recommended that this task be pursued (decontamination of basement and stabilizing material in WHUT room); however, the evaluation of i

the feasibility of decontaminating and decommissioning the WHUT room should be made by AMS.

i Task 4,. Hydrological Stabilization of the Basement.

This task addresses the issue of water collecting in the underground drains and flowing to the new t

i manhole _which is presently isolated from the area sewer system. AMS presently collects this water in hold-up tanks, analyses the water for cobalt-60, then discharges it to a catch basin if the analysis shows no cobalt-60 content.

1 There is presently a separate request from AMS, dated June 25, 1996, requesting authorization to discharge directly from the manhole to the catch basin with no hold-up for analysis, and sampling the water once a week from the manhole instead, to verify that the water from the underground drain is not contaminated from the soil surrounding the underground drain. This issue is being addressed in a separate TAR, expected to be completed by early September.

. Task 5, Modifying Conceptual Decommissioning Plan and Decommissioning Funding Plan.

This task discusses the resubmittal of the Conceptual Decommissioning Plan and a subsequent Decommissioning Funding Plan in light of the decrease in inventory and the unrestricted release of parts of the London Road facility.

Pursuant to the completion of disposal of the 40,000 curies or so of bulk and sealed cobalt-60 sources, $nd of the low-level waste generated from decontamination of the facility, the estimates of cost for decommissioning of the facility should be readdressed. However, in all the correspondence to i

date, AMS has emphasized and requested approval for SAFSTOR methodology for l

J its cost estimates; all correspondence from Headquarters addressing this issue bave indicated why SAFSTOR would not be an option, and that the Generic

3 s

Environmental Impact Statement (GEIS), NUREG-0586, intends SAFSTOR to be an allowed use of a safe storage for a few days to a few months for material licensees. This continues to be our position.

In addition, in a letter from Kevin Null to David Cesar dated August 5,1996, condition number 24 was added to AMS' license to require that AMS submit to NRC for review a revised i;

Conceptual Decommissioning Plan (CDP) and cost estimate not later than August 1

30, 1996, and, assuming NRC approval of the CDP, a revised Decommissioning Funding Plan that will contain a description of a new decommissioning 4

financial instrument not later than September 15, 1996. NRC will review this new plan upon its arrival.

Task 6, Free Release Remainder of Building.

This task discusses the characterization and remediation of the London Road facility, similar to Task 3 but referring to decommissioning the areas outside of the basement.

After decontamination, surveys pursuant to NUREG-5849, " Manual for Conducting Radiological Surveys in Support of License Termination," will be performed by AMS, submitted to the NRC, with a request for confirmatory surveys for all but the WHUT room, Hot Cell, and the ventilation room.

This task is approved.

Task 7, Request Ex aption from Physical Inventory.

This task discusses AMS intention to request an exemption from the inventory license condition and discusses the reasons for this request.

Because the plug to the storage well has become lodged, physical inventory of the sources in the well is not possible. A license condition (14.c.) requires that an inventory be performed by June 1, 1993, and every 60 months thereafter. At present, the licensee is in violation of that condition, as noted in a letter to AMS dated August 13, 1993, although attempts have been made to remove the plug.

Review and determination by the NRC will be made with the information that is provided when the exemption request is submitted.

In the meantime, the determination of what should be in the well should be established from past inventories.

There is a large variation in the quantity of material that AMS has estimated to be present in the well, depending on which piece of correspondence is read (June 10, 1996 BRP letter indicates approximately 3000 curies of cobalt-60, while July 10, 1996, Revision 3 of Strategic Plan estimates 4000 cut.es of cobal t-60).

Task 8, Request Exemption from Emergency Plan Requirements. This task discusses the requirement for an Emergency Plan in accordance with 10 CFR 30.32 in light of the large possession limit authorized in the license. After completion of Tasks 1 and 2 of the BRP, license quantity limit requirements should be significantly reduced, from maximum amounts of 150,000 curies of solid metal and 135,000 curies of sealed cobalt-60 in AMS' present license, to a maximum of 10,000 curies, including the cobalt-60 in the plug well. AMS also indicates that the cobalt-60 will be sealed, non-dispersible material.

After disposition of all disposable material, AMS should first submit an amendment to modify the possession limit on the license (see task 10), and, after receiving a lower possession limit, submit either an Emergency Plan in accordance with 10 CFR 31.32, using Regulatory Guide 3.67, " Standard Format and Content for Emergency Plans of Fuel Cycle and Material Facilities," and NUREG-ll40, "A Regulatory Analysis on Emergency Preparedness for Fuel Cycle and Other Radioactive Material Licensees," as guidance, or, in accordance with Title 10 CFR 30.32(i)(1), an evaluation that indicates that a dose of I rem effective dose equivalent or 5 rem to thyroid could not be delivered to a member offsite (which AMS indicates it could show).

i a

o Task 9, Request Extension of Safe Storage Pericd for WHUT Room. This task describes the desire of the licensee to continue the WHUT room in a storage capacity based on personnel exposure and waste volume considerations.

Revisiting the WHUT room evaluation of whether to continue existing storage of the room, or decontaminate, should be performed at least as often as a license renewal, taking into consideration As Low As Reasonably Achievable analyses.

AMS should be reminded that the longer the storage of the WHUT room, the longer its remediation will need to be considered in the estimation of decommissioning costs, and the higher the cost of the decommissioning funding i

instrument, coupled with the rising cost of waste disposal and inflation.

Consideration of continued storage will be based on the information provided in AMS' request for storage extension.

Task 10, Request Reduction'in License Limit.

This task will request a reduction in the licensed maximum possession limit of radioactive material.

3 As indicated in the Task 8 discussion, this should be accomplished by AMS as soon as possible after Tasks I and 2 are completed.

The decommissioning funding plan is based on the quantity of material the licensee is authorized to possess, and therefore, the funding plan complexity and liability coverage might be reduced by a reduction of the possession limit. Although the

" quantity" criteria for having to consider an emergency plan is still exceeded, the development and analysis of the plan, and the demonstration of the potential of exposing an offsite individual to less than I rem effective dose equivalent would be easier to complete.

Task 11, Submit Long-Range Strategic Plan.

This task discusses AMS' on-going plan to issue subsequent revisions to its Strategic Plan. AMS submitted its latest revision dated July 10, 1996.

AMS should continue to submit the plan since it provides information on progress made by AMS to resolve identified issues.

Task 12, Perform Routine Operations and Meet Regulatory Comitments. This task discusses AMS' intention to track outstanding regulatory and compliance issues along with th. above 11 tasks. Although this task does not generate a deliverable item except the task list of the BRP, the NRC can review this present list in the future to monitor progress of activities at AMS.
